## -*- texinfo -*-
## @documentencoding UTF-8
## @deftypemethod {@@infsupdec} {@var{X} =} powrev1 (@var{B}, @var{C}, @var{X})
## @deftypemethodx {@@infsupdec} {@var{X} =} powrev1 (@var{B}, @var{C})
##
## Compute the reverse power function for the first parameter.
##
## That is, an enclosure of all @code{x ∈ @var{X}} where
## @code{pow (x, b) ∈ @var{C}} for any @code{b ∈ @var{B}}.
##
## Accuracy: The result is a valid enclosure.
##
## @comment DO NOT SYNCHRONIZE DOCUMENTATION STRING
## No one way of decorating this operations gives useful information in all
## contexts. Therefore, the result will carry a @code{trv} decoration at best.
##
## @example
## @group
## powrev1 (infsupdec (2, 5), infsupdec (3, 6))
## @result{} ans ⊂ [1.2457, 2.4495]_trv
## @end group
## @end example
## @seealso{@@infsupdec/pow}
## @end deftypemethod

function result = powrev1 (b, c, x)
if (nargin < 2 || nargin > 3)
print_usage ();
return
endif
if (nargin < 3)
x = infsupdec (-inf, inf);
endif
if (not (isa (b, "infsupdec")))
b = infsupdec (b);
endif
if (not (isa (c, "infsup")))
c = infsupdec (c);
endif
if (not (isa (x, "infsupdec")))
x = infsupdec (x);
endif
## inverse power is not a point function
result = infsupdec (powrev1 (b.infsup, c.infsup, x.infsup), "trv");
result.dec(isnai (x) | isnai (b) | isnai (c)) = _ill ();
endfunction
